Experience
Dr. Mazin Rasool Aljabiri is a Consultant Physician and Gastroenterologist at Mediclinic Dubai Mall. With more than 15 years experience in gastroenterology, Dr. Aljabiri has recently relocated to Dubai from the UK where he held a consultant gastroenterologist and general physician post in one of the teaching university hospitals.
He has extensive experience in endoscopy, and has performed more than 4,000 colonoscopies and 10,000 gastroscopies. He is also experienced in managing difficult ERCP cases and has a keen interest in Inflamatory Bowel Disease and hepatology, including managing patients with liver transplant, after working with the Royal Free Hospital – one of the leading liver transplant centres in the UK.
Dr. Mazin is also experienced in oesophageal/pyloric/duodenal and colonic balloon dilatations and stent insertions. His main interest is intervention endoscopy, including bowel cancer screening and has performed more than 450 polypectomies for which he received extensive training in Japan including Endoscopic Submucosal Dissection (ESD).
Very active in the medical education field, Dr. Aljabiri regularly presents abstracts and lectures at national and international conferences, and has taught membership courses for the MRCP exams for Royal College of Physicians in the UK. His clinical memberships include the American Gastroenterology Association (AGA), the British Society of Gastroenterology (BSG), the Royal College of Physicians (RCP), the British Medical Council (BMA), and the General Medical Council (GMC).
